
This is a postcard with pictures of the 1986 Finnish Christmas stamps. I found the following information on Stamp Collecting Blog.
In 1986 the Finnish Post issued their first, and so far also the last, se-tenant Christmas postage stamp issue. At the same time Christmas postage stamps returned back to use of two separate face values: discounted rate for early domestic mail and regular rate stamps for normal and international delivery.
